We knew that EA was handling Battlefield 1‘s rent-a-server options directly, but it’s now been revealed the feature won’t be offered at launch.
“Following the Battlefield 1 launch, we will start rolling out a Rent-a-Server Program that will allow players to set up their own private and public Battlefield 1 servers, with control of different gameplay options to map rotations,” EA recently detailed.
“Starting close after launch, you will be able to rent a server through the in-game store of Battlefield 1,” EA’s post continued.
We’ll let you know when exact availability is detailed.
Battlefield 1 heads to Windows PC, Xbox One and PS4 later in the month.
